Through an almost angelic cascade of a fine mist descending upon Yankee Stadium, the Philadelphia Phillies struck first blood in a 6-1 áwin. In a night that was regarded as a huge showdown of old lefty teammates, Cliff Lee and C.C. Sabathia, the Phillies overcame a powerful Yankee hitting squad with a lights out, 10 strikeout performance by Cliff Lee. But it wasnÆt only the pitching that was the highlight here. Anyone remember the two bad throws Chase Utley had in the NLCS? Yeah, me either, thanks in part to UtleyÆs performance that single-handedly beat the Bronx Bombers. Utley became the first person to have a multiple HR game in a World Series since Ryan Howard, and if that isnÆt an indication of things to come then I donÆt know what is. Now ...
